DAKINE Cobra Mitten

DAKINE Cobra Mitten

Rating for this product: 5 January 8, 2009

These mitts perform to manufacturer specs. They keep you warm and dry. And fit true to size. What more could you ask for. I live in the midwest and the winters can be pretty brutal. The coldest I've had these out was about 25-30 deg.f with 0 deg. wind chill. My hands were nice and toasty. They were a little sweaty though. My only knocks are the nose wipe panels (could be a bit more comfortable)and the fact that the leather is pretty thin. The leather is holding up after a few snowboard days. But I guess time will tell.
